About Palermo
Palermo is the main city of the autonomous region of Sicily in Italy. It dates back to ancient times, founded by Phoenician merchants in the 8th c. B.C. on the island's north-western coast and named Ziz. The Greek called it Panormus, meaning "harbour". The Phonicians controlled it until the First Punic War (246-241 B.C.), then Sicily came under Roman rule. With the split of the Roman Empire, it became part of Byzantine territory. The Saracens arrived in the 9th century and made Palermo a leading commercial and cultural center. It is said to have had 300 mosques! The Arab rule was a period of peace and tolerance: Christians and Jews were not persecuted. The Normans conquered the island in 1091, and a century later it fell under the rule of the Holy Roman Empire. In the late 13th century Sicily came under the Aragonese kings, and in the late 15th c. became part of the Spanish Kingdom. In 1734 it unified with the kingdom of Naples and lost some of its significance. In 1860 Sicily was annexed to the Kingdom of Italy and Palermo flourished as the island's administrative center. World War II brought an Allied invasion and heavy damage, and the post-war years were marked by the power of the Mafia which continues to be an issue today.
